The earliest manuscript “book” evidence for a complete Greek New Testament is Codex Sinaiticus, from the 4th Century, acquired by Tischendorf fin 1859 from the Monastery of Saint Catherine on Mount Sinai.

The earliest manuscript “book” evidence for an entire Greek Bible, OT and NT, is **Codex Vaticanus ** from the mid 4th. C., which has been in the Vatican Library for unknown centuries (at least 530 years)…
